2024-11-29 06:42:03
随着区块链技术的飞速发展,数字货币的使用逐渐普及,钱包作为用户存储、发送和接收数字货币的重要工具,越来越受到关注。其中,签名档作为钱包中关键的安全特性之一,它的功能不仅保证了交易的安全性,还提升了用户对自己财产的控制能力。本文将详细探讨区块链钱包签名档的概念、功能、使用方法、安全性以及相关问题,为用户提供一个全面的理解和实用指南。
区块链钱包签名档是由私钥生成的一种数字签名,用于验证交易的来源以及确保交易的不可抵赖性。每当用户进行数字货币交易时,钱包便会利用存储在其中的私钥对交易数据进行签名。这个签名档不仅包含了交易的相关信息,还能证明交易的发起者拥有足够的资金进行此次交易。
签名档的生成过程涉及到复杂的数学算法,主要通过公钥密码学来确保安全性。从技术角度来看,私钥是生成签名档的核心,而公钥则用于验证签名的真实性。换句话说,拥有私钥的人才能发起交易,而任何人都可以通过公钥来验证这种交易的有效性。
签名档在区块链钱包中主要承担以下几项重要功能:
1. **确保交易的真实性**:通过对交易信息的数字签名,签名档可以有效证明交易的有效性,防止伪造和篡改。
2. **增强安全性**:只有拥有相应私钥的用户才能进行交易,这种特性使得数字货币交易在一定程度上具有高度的安全性。
3. **确保交易的不可否认性**:签名档不仅能够确保交易的附加信息,还能够在未来的任何时候证明这笔交易确实是用户所发起的,从而增强用户的信任感。
4. **支持多重签名功能**:一些钱包支持多重签名功能,即需要多个私钥的联合签名才能发起交易,这样可以进一步提升安全性。
使用区块链钱包签名档的过程相对简单,用户只需按照以下步骤进行操作:
1. **创建钱包**:用户首先需要选择一款可靠的区块链钱包,并进行注册或创建新钱包。在这个过程中,钱包会生成一组公钥和私钥。
2. **备份私钥**:为了确保账户安全,用户应及时备份私钥,并妥善保存,切勿将其泄露给任何人。
3. **发起交易**:当用户需要进行交易时,他们只需输入交易信息(如接收地址和金额),系统会自动生成签名档以进行确认。
4. **签名发送**:系统使用私钥对交易进行签名后,会将生成的签名档与交易信息一并发送到区块链网络中。
5. **交易确认**:网络中的节点会通过公钥对签名进行验证,确保交易有效后将其记录到区块链上。
区块链钱包的安全性很大程度上取决于签名档的安全性。以下是一些保障签名档安全的措施:
1. **保护私钥**:私钥是生成签名档的关键,因此妥善保护私钥是保障交易安全的首要任务。用户应避免将私钥存储在互联网上或轻易分享给他人。
2. **使用冷钱包**:冷钱包,即离线钱包,是一种更加安全存储数字资产的方式. 通过将私钥离线拷贝或使用硬件钱包,用户能够在一定程度上避免网络攻击。
3. **启用双重认证**:许多钱包支持双重认证功能。用户在每次交易时都需提供另一种身份验证方式,这为用户账户提供了额外的安全保障。
4. **定期审核交易记录**:用户应定期查看自己的交易记录,及时发现异常情况。若发现任何未授权的交易,及时采取措施进行冻结或报警。
### 相关问题探讨选择安全的区块链钱包是保护用户资产的重要环节,以下是一些实用的建议:
1. **支持的货币种类**:不同的钱包支持不同类型的数字货币,用户应选择能够支持自己资产的钱包。例如,如果你持有比特币和以太坊,选择一个支持这两种资产的钱包更为合适。
2. **钱包类型**:钱包主要分为热钱包和冷钱包。热钱包(在线钱包)使用方便,但相对安全性较低;冷钱包(硬件钱包等)虽操作较复杂,但安全性更高。用户应根据自己的需求和安全水平选择合适的钱包类型。
3. **开发团队与社区支持**:选择由知名团队或公司开发的钱包可以有效降低安全风险,看看用户的评价和社区反馈也非常重要。
4. **附加安全功能**:许多钱包会提供双重认证、多重签名以及加密措施,用户在选择时应优先考虑这些附加的安全功能。
签名档的丢失可能会导致用户无法进行交易,甚至可能丧失数字资产。以下是一些应对措施:
1. **恢复私钥的方式**:如果用户配备了助记词或其他恢复工具,可以按照钱包的指示进行恢复。助记词通常是在创建钱包时生成的,可以用于恢复丢失的私钥。
2. **查询交易历史**:用户可以通过公钥查询自己的交易历史,以确认没有异常行为。如果一旦发现相关的交易,可以尝试冻结账户或联系钱包的客服进行处理。
3. **及时采取行动**:一旦用户意识到签名档丢失,必须立即采取相应措施,修改安全设置和确认密码以免资产受损。
4. **寻求专业帮助**:如果用户没有找到办法恢复,可以向专业的安全服务机构寻求帮助,看是否有可能找到丢失的签名档或进行资产追踪。
区块链签名和传统签名之间存在着明显的区别:
1. **技术实现**: 区块链签名利用公钥密码学,在交易发起者使用私钥签名后,任何人都可以通过公钥验证签名。这一过程是基于复杂的数学算法,而传统的签名通常依赖于手写的图案和法律效力。
2. **不可篡改性**: 区块链签名是不可篡改的,一旦交易被验证并记录到区块链上,便无法改动。而传统的签名相对较容易被伪造,且其法律效力需要依赖法律机构的确认。
3. **透明性与匿名性**: 区块链签名允许交易记录被公开审核和验证,而用户的身份却可以处于匿名状态。传统签名通常需要实名登记,其透明度相对较低。
4. **效率与速度**: 区块链签名能够实现实时交易处理,相比之下,传统签名在交易完成后需要一定的时间进行确认和验证。尤其在跨境交易时,区块链的高效性更为显著。
保护数字货币不受黑客攻击的策略非常关键,以下是一些有效的方法:
1. **长期使用冷钱包**:将大部分数字资产存储在冷钱包中,只有在需要进行交易时才将其转到热钱包中。这可以有效减少 hackers 对资产的攻击机会。
2. **使用强密码和双重认证**:所有账户和钱包都应使用强密码,并启用双重认证,确保即使密码被盗,黑客也无法轻易访问账户。
3. **警惕钓鱼攻击**:用户应当警惕钓鱼攻击,特别是在点击不明链接或下载未知应用时需格外小心。时刻检查域名,确保访问的是官方通道。
4. **定期更新软件**:无论是钱包应用还是操作系统,都应定期更新,确保使用最新的安全防护措施。
5. **进行安全审计**:若通过第三方平台进行交易,建议选择具有安全审计和合规认证的平台,以降低安全风险。
区块链钱包签名档作为数字货币交易中的核心部分,其重要性不言而喻。掌握如何使用、保障安全性以及进行有效的风险防范,能够帮助用户更好地管理和保护自己的数字资产。在这个飞速发展的区块链时代,确保交易的安全和透明,才能在数字货币的浪潮中立于不败之地。